August 06, 2014Couch Talk 130 - Gordon GreenidgeFormer West Indian opener Gordon Greenidge talks about the mental and technical aspects of opening the batting, what is expected of a Test opener, his partnership with Desmond Haynes over the years, the great team he played in and the phenomenal 214 he made at Lord’s 1984 to secure an improbable victory for West Indies in just over 2 sessions chasing 344 runs....more47minPlay
July 29, 2014Couch Talk 129 - Alex KountourisAustralian national cricket team’s lead physiotherapist Alex Kountouris talks about the health management of cricketers, the impact of T20s, fast bowler injuries, comparing Asian and non-Asian teams, and the cricket health of several Australians including Ryan Harris and Shane Watson....more37minPlay
July 16, 2014Couch Talk 128 - Dean JonesFormer Australian batsman Dean Jones talks about his legendary double hundred in the 1986 Madras Tied Test, his growth as a batsman, Allan Border’s role in cricket’s resurgence in Australia, Michael Clarke’s captaincy, facing up to fast bowlers, his excellence in ODIs, Indian Cricket League (ICL) and his on-air off-color comment about Hashim Amla amongst other things....more41minPlay
July 09, 2014Couch Talk 127 - Curtly AmbroseFormer West Indies great Sir Curly Ambrose talks about the Caribbean Premier League (CPL) T20, his new role as bowling consultant of West Indies, his playing career, his memorable contests and also bowling alongside Courtney Walsh....more17minPlay
June 24, 2014Couch Talk 126 - Colin CroftIn this episode, former West Indian fast bower Colin Croft talks about his international career that lasted only 27 Tests, his attitude towards his craft and cricket, the great West Indies teams he played on, the pressure on the modern cricketers amongst other things....more46minPlay
June 18, 2014Couch Talk 125 - Kartikeya Date, Ahmer NaqviIn this episode, two very popular cricket bloggers, Kartikeya Date and Ahmer Naqvi talk about the game of T20, what it has become, how it is perceived, it’s impact on cricket as a whole, what it actually is, and what it should be....more49minPlay
May 28, 2014Couch Talk 124 - Mignon du PreezSouth Africa captain Mignon du Preez talks about her team’s improvement in the last few years, the need for professionalism in women’s cricket, and the country’s attitude towards women’s sport....more31minPlay
May 14, 2014Couch Talk 123 - Atul WassanFormer India bowler talks about his playing career, lack of fast bowlers in India, the current crop of Indian pacers, watching Sachin Tendulkar get to his maiden century, amongst other things....more20minPlay
May 06, 2014Couch Talk 122 - Roland ButcherFormer England batsman Roland Butcher, now director of sports at the University of West Indies, talks of his cricket and football careers, and his work in developing sport in the Caribbean, and the responsibility of being the first black cricketer to represent England....more31minPlay
April 29, 2014Couch Talk 121 - Sanjay ManjrekarIn this episode, Former India batsman and current commentator Sanjay Manjrekar on dealing with expectations and batting failures, and the perils of criticizing Tendulkar....more35minPlay
